You're saying it will maintain 3.5 watts of output power with a 2v input?

It only does 3 watts into 33 ohms with 2v so this sounds off. What would the power be at 50 ohms with 2v input?
If 2V input then 2W. The problem is what's the deal if you are going to attenuate it anyway?

Believe me 2W is much more than enough, unless you also do EQ. 100mW will get you very loud.
For 4V dacs, D10 Balanced is going to be released in 3 days. You may want to look at that. If you want the full power out of A30pro of course.
And yeah, amps don't really have much of a difference. You should benefit more from EQ and using better headphones. (I see you are having He6se v2). So yeah. Enjoy music.
